WebToxic Chemicals at Joint Base Balad in Iraq. As shown in the burn pits map above, the largest burn pit – at Joint Base Balad in Iraq – expanded to an area of almost 20 acres. At its peak, it burned about 200 tons of solid waste every day. The Balad burn pit emitted hundreds of toxic chemicals, exposing veterans to highly contaminated air. WebThe 5th SFG (A) was constituted on 15 April 1960 in the Regular Army and designated Headquarters and Headquarters Company, 5th SFG (A), 1st Special Forces. On September 21, 1961, the 5th SFG (A) was officially activated at Fort Bragg, North Carolina. This comprehensive health exam includes an exposure and medical history, laboratory tests, and a physical exam. A VA health professional will discuss the results face-to-face with the Veteran and in a follow-up letter. Veterans should follow up with their primary care provider for care and treatment if ...
